Abstract

Poverty declines. 96,000 of the 1.1 million people living in Saskatchewan in 2018 were poor. While poverty increased in 2017, it declined in 2018, following a long-term downward trend in poverty rates from 2006 to 2016. Most of the 2018 decline was among children, with little change in the number of poor non-elderly adults.

Description
This report summarizes Saskatchewan poverty trends and patterns from 2006 to 2018 using the Official Poverty Line…
